Домашняя страница > Изучение Языка Java > Основы языка
Вопросы и Упражнения: Операторы управления
Вопросы
- Самый основной оператор управления, поддерживаемый языком программирования Java, является ___ оператором.
- ___ оператор учитывает любое число возможных путей выполнения.
- ___ оператор подобен
while
оператор, но оценивает его выражение в ___ цикла.
- Как делают Вы пишете бесконечный цикл, используя
for
оператор?
- Как делают Вы пишете бесконечный цикл, используя
while
оператор?
Упражнения
-
Рассмотрите следующий фрагмент кода.
if (aNumber >= 0)
if (aNumber == 0)
System.out.println("first string");
else System.out.println("second string");
System.out.println("third string");
- Что выводит, делают Вы думаете, что код произведет если
aNumber
3?
- Запишите тестовую программу, содержащую предыдущий фрагмент кода; сделать
aNumber
3. Каков вывод программы? Это - то, что Вы предсказали? Объясните, почему вывод состоит в том, каково это; другими словами, каков поток управления для фрагмента кода?
- Используя только пробелы и разрывы строки, переформатируйте фрагмент кода, чтобы сделать поток управления легче понять.
- Используйте фигурные скобки, {и}, чтобы далее разъяснить код.
Проверьте свои ответы